All of these are fairly useful for the different dimensions they look at :
Ginsburgs, George and Carl Pinkele, The Sino-Soviet territorial dispute, 1949-64 (New York: Praeger Publishers, 1978)
Gittings, John, Survey of the Sino-Soviet Dispute, a commentary and extracts from the recent polemics 1963-1967 (London: Oxford University Press, 1969)
Low, Alfred, The Sino-Soviet Dispute, an analysis of the polemics (London: Associated University Presses Inc., 1976)
This one book is very good for an overview, particularly the ideological side, it has must more recent historiography and benefits from access to Soviet archives since the collapse of the Soviet Union :
Luthi, Lorenz, The Sino-Soviet split: Cold War in the Communist World (Princeton: Princeton University Press, 2008)
Really good for a very general and basic overview:
Quested, Rosemary, Sino-Russian relations (Boston: George Allen & Unwin Ltd, 1984)
Useful article on how Nuclear Weapons helped shaped relations:
Chao-wu, Dai, ‘The Development of China's Nuclear Weapons and the Rupture of Sino-Soviet Relations (1954—1962)’, Contemporary China History Studies, 27.0 (2006) 1-16 http://en.cnki.com.cn/Article_en/CJFDTOTAL-DZSY200103014.htm [Accessed 20 March 2013]
Good article on how the ideological differences straigned the realtionship: Shen, Zhihua and Yafeng Xia, ‘The Great Leap Forward, the People’s Communes and the Sino-Soviet Split’, Journal of Contemporary China, 20.72 (2011) 861-880 http://0www.tandfonline.com.wam.leeds.ac.uk/doi/abs/10.1080/10670564.2011.604505 [Accessed 8 February 2013]
